我在.aspx页面的一个部分中为某些输入字段赋予了"required"
属性,因此该部分中的按钮需要验证此字段。同一页面的其他部分还有其他按钮。
现在问题是在所有按钮点击事件中验证此字段。我能够通过将"formnovalidate"
属性赋予页面中的其余按钮来解决此问题。
还有其他(更好!)方式可以解决这个问题吗?
我不想通过编写一些javacsript验证来与"required"
属性妥协。
此外,我不想在页面的其他按钮中编写任何代码/添加任何属性。
还有其他更好的解决方案来解决这个问题吗?
答案 0 :(得分:0)
您可以使用validationgroup msdn
答案 1 :(得分:0)
有一个简单的解决方案,我错过了:
function assignAttribute() {
var b1 = document.getElementById('txtName');
b1.setAttribute("required", "reqired");
}
我们可以通过按钮的OnClientClick上的javascript函数指定“required”属性。